Funding pattern

What this funder pays for, at what size, and how to position adjacent work. Read from their filings, with every number checked against the record.

Where the money goes

  • Culturally specific immigrant and refugee service organizations in King County
  • Civil legal aid and eviction prevention (King County Bar Association)
  • Family homelessness, shelter, and housing stability programs
  • Youth and family services, mentoring, and violence interruption
  • Community college student basic needs and emergency cash aid
  • Community food access, food banks, and urban farming

Typical grant

The median grant is about $50,500, with the middle half falling between roughly $14,000 and $150,000. The largest checks, $600,000 to $1.67 million, go to long-established multiservice agencies and the legal aid infrastructure: Neighborhood House, King County Bar Association, Atlantic Street Center, Southwest Youth & Family Services, Mary's Place. Giving repeats heavily, 926 grants to only 466 recipients over four years, so most funded organizations are getting money in more than one year.

Positioning adjacent work

  • Partner with a King County community-based organization as lead applicant; they fund service delivery, not investigator-led research.
  • Connect to the community college basic-needs cluster: Highline, Seattle Colleges, Green River, Renton Technical, Shoreline, Cascadia, plus Edquity.
  • Ask in the $100,000 to $200,000 band; repeated exact amounts like $103,134 and $195,385 mark real cohort tiers.
  • Emphasize direct benefits access, cash assistance, and culturally specific delivery in South King County (Kent, Burien, Renton, SeaTac).

Worth knowing: This is functionally a King County funder: 832 of 926 grants stay in Washington, and the out-of-state exceptions are platform or intermediary partners (Edquity in Brooklyn, Allied Media Projects, The Praxis Project, AmeriCorps VISTA) rather than independent grantees. Dozens of grants land on identical dollar amounts, which signals cohort-based pooled rounds and existing relationships more than open competitive review; one 2024 payment even went to a named individual.<br>Only one grant in the visible record went to the University of Washington, at exactly $100,000, so academic institutions are a rounding error here.</br>
